#f0fa00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0fa00 is composed of 94.1% red, 98%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 62.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 49%. #f0fa00 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#e1f500. Closest websafe color is: #ffff00.

#f0fa00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0fa00 has RGB values of R:240, G:250,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:1,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 15792640.

Shades and Tints of #f0fa00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0f00 is the darkest color, while #fffff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0fa00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868773 is the less saturated color, while #f0fa00 is the most saturated one.
